Pros

The majority of the workers are nice. The job is really straight forward; just cut fruit and package them on to the shelves. If you like or don't mind working alone then this is a position that gives you that kind of environment. There are some days where there might be someone cutting fruit with you. For example, I come in while someone was already cutting then they'll leave after their shift is done; then I'll be alone.

Cons

If you don't like working alone then this position may not be for you. There might be some days where you'll be cutting fruit by yourself. Occasionally you'll work with someone but most likely you won't be scheduled to start at the same time they start. So you'll either be alone for a couple hours before they come in, or be alone after the other persons shift is over. When things get busy it's not so bad when there is somebody else cutting with you, but it can be overwhelming when you are alone.
